📖 How Car Blogs Still Make Money
Car blogs can tap into multiple income streams. The most successful blogs diversify so they aren’t dependent on just one method.
1. Display Ads
- Ad networks like Google AdSense, Ezoic, and Mediavine pay per click or per thousand impressions.
- Automotive keywords tend to have high CPC rates due to competitive advertisers.
- Example: A site with 50,000 monthly visits could earn $1,000–$3,000/month in ads alone.
2. Affiliate Marketing
- Promote products like car parts, tools, detailing supplies, and accessories using affiliate links.
- Popular programs: Amazon Associates, CJ Affiliate, ShareASale.
- Example: A detailing blog could earn commissions on ceramic coatings, polishers, or microfiber towels.
3. Sponsored Posts
- Automotive brands and aftermarket companies pay for reviews, guides, or product launches.
- Rates range from $200 to $1,000+ per post depending on your reach.
4. Selling Digital Products
- eBooks, repair manuals, detailing courses, or photography guides.
- Low overhead, high profit margins.
5. Merchandise
- Branded shirts, hats, mugs, or posters for fans.
6. Services
- Consulting, photography, SEO services, or car-buying assistance.
📊 Car Blog Income Potential
Earnings vary based on your traffic, niche, and monetization approach.
Blog Type | Monthly Traffic | Income Potential |
---|---|---|
New Car Blog | 1,000/mo | $20–$100/month |
Hobby Car Blog | 5,000/mo | $150–$500/month |
Niche Car Blog | 15K+/mo | $500–$2,000+/month |
Pro Car Blog Site | 50K+/mo | $3,000–$10,000+/month |
💡 With solid SEO, engaging content, and diversified income streams, a car blog can become a full-time business.
⚙️ Choosing a Profitable Car Blog Niche
Not every automotive niche is equally lucrative. The best niches balance strong audience demand with high-value monetization opportunities.
Top Earning Car Blog Niches
Niche | Monetization Potential |
---|---|
Classic Car Restoration | High — parts, tools, courses |
Off-Road & Overlanding | High — aftermarket gear |
Electric Vehicles (EVs) | Medium–High — accessories, news |
Performance Tuning | Very High — parts, tuning devices |
Car Detailing & Care | High — detailing products, training |
📈 Driving Traffic to Your Car Blog
Traffic is the foundation of monetization. Without visitors, even the best monetization plan won’t work.
1. Search Engine Optimization (SEO)
- Use keyword tools like Ahrefs, SEMRush, or Ubersuggest.
- Target long-tail keywords such as “best ceramic coating for black cars” or “how to replace brake pads on a Honda Civic.”
- Optimize titles, headings, meta descriptions, images, and internal links.
2. Social Media
- YouTube: Great for tutorials, reviews, and project builds.
- Instagram & TikTok: Perfect for short-form car content and visual storytelling.
3. Pinterest
- Works well for how-to guides, before/after photos, and infographics.
- Create vertical pins for every blog post to keep traffic flowing.
🚀 Steps to Start a Profitable Car Blog
- Pick Your Niche — Choose a topic you’re passionate about and that has strong monetization potential.
- Get a Domain & Hosting — Invest in a reliable, fast-loading hosting provider.
- Install WordPress & Theme — Choose a clean, responsive theme optimized for SEO.
- Install Essential Plugins — Include SEO, caching, and image optimization plugins.
- Create a Content Plan — Aim for at least 2–4 SEO-rich posts per week.
- Promote Your Blog — Use SEO, social media, and Pinterest.
- Monetize — Layer in ads, affiliate links, and digital products.
⚠️ Common Mistakes in Car Blogging
- No keyword research before writing.
- Copying manufacturer press releases without adding value.
- Posting inconsistently.
- Ignoring email list building.
- Relying on just one source of income.
